Name | Role on Show / In Family | Brief Description |
---|---|---|
Phil Robertson | Patriarch, Founder of Duck Commander | The wise, outspoken founder, known for his traditional values and deep love for duck hunting. |
Kay Robertson | Matriarch, Phil's Wife | The warm, loving mother figure, famous for her cooking and caring nature. |
Willie Robertson | CEO of Duck Commander, Phil's Son | The business-savvy son who modernized the company and brought it to national fame. |
Korie Robertson | Willie's Wife, Business Partner | Willie's supportive wife, who also played a key role in the business and family life. |
Jase Robertson | Phil's Son, Duck Call Maker | The laid-back brother, known for his skill in duck calling and his humorous antics. |
Missy Robertson | Jase's Wife | A kind and patient presence, often seen balancing family life with her husband's hobbies. |
Si Robertson | Phil's Brother, Uncle to the Sons | The eccentric, tea-drinking uncle, famous for his funny stories and unique sayings. |
Jep Robertson | Phil's Youngest Son, Videographer | The quietest of the brothers, often seen filming the family's hunting adventures. |
Jessica Robertson | Jep's Wife | Jep's lively wife, who brought a fresh energy to the family dynamic. |
Sadie Robertson Huff | Willie & Korie's Daughter | A prominent younger generation member, known for her positive influence and public speaking. |
John Luke Robertson | Willie & Korie's Son | Another of Willie and Korie's children, often seen growing up on the show. |

Si Robertson: The Uncle
Uncle Si, Phil's brother, is arguably one of the most beloved and memorable members of the duck dynasty full cast. His unique personality, his constant tea drinking, and his often-rambling stories made him an instant fan favorite. Si, you know, provided endless comic relief with his unpredictable antics and his signature phrase, "Hey!" He's a Vietnam veteran with a heart of gold, someone who truly cares about his family.
His stories, whether about his time in the military or his everyday observations, were always delivered with a special charm. Si's innocence and his quirky outlook on life were a constant source of laughter. He's a simple man who finds joy in the little things, like a fresh glass of iced tea or a good joke. His presence on the show was always a highlight, and he's truly one of a kind. He's, like, your favorite uncle, but on television.

Sadie Robertson Huff: The Next Generation
Sadie Robertson Huff, Willie and Korie's daughter, emerged as a prominent voice from the younger generation of the duck dynasty full cast. She gained popularity beyond the show, participating in "Dancing with the Stars" and becoming a motivational speaker. Sadie, you might say, represents the family's enduring values passed down to a new era. She's a positive role model for many young people, sharing messages of faith and self-acceptance.
Her journey has been very public, from her teenage years on the show to her marriage and motherhood. Sadie's ability to connect with a broad audience is truly impressive. She's a confident and articulate young woman who uses her platform for good. Her influence extends far beyond the realm of reality television, and she's, quite frankly, built a significant following. She's, in a way, carrying on the family's legacy in a new light.
